GREY LYNN DRUIDS.
The ordjgary meeting of the Grey Lynn Lodge, U.A.0.D., was held on Wednesday evening when there was a good attendance, including official visitors from Ponsonby, Waitemata, and Auckland Lodges. A strong committee was set up to go into ways and means to assist a member who is in distress owing to prolonged illness. At the close of the meeting the Rev. Jasper Calder delivered a very interesting and instructive address, hia subject being, "Some Topics of the Great War." The speaker, who took a very optimistic view of the struggle, was frequently applauded. A hearty vote of thanks was carried by acclamation.
